Sceptered Isle: The Story of the Fourteenth Century with Dr Helen Carr (ep 223)

S5 E223 · British History: Royals, Rebels, and Romantics
Avatar
0 Plays17 days ago

Fourteenth century England was a time of upheaval, extended war, political turmoil, and overall chaos. Dr Helen Carr joins us to talk about her new book that covers the life of the famous and lesser-known people of a time that changed power structures and the monarchy forever.
